What Is a Baby Food Lawsuit Lawyer Handle?
A baby food lawsuit lawyer is a personal injury attorney who handles claims that stem from contaminated or defective baby food products. These attorneys handle product liability claims against product makers who marketed products tainted by lead, arsenic, mercury, or cadmium.
In practical terms, the process of a baby food lawsuit lawyer spans scientific and courtroom strategy alike. To start, your attorney compiles and examines diagnostic documentation to confirm the nature and extent of the harm your child suffered. Following that, they work alongside toxicologists and scientists who can connect the contamination to the developmental outcome. At the litigation stage, the lawyer initiates legal action in the correct jurisdiction and negotiates a settlement or proceeds to trial.
This area of law relies heavily on government findings published in 2021 confirming that major infant food manufacturers including Beech-Nut, Gerber, and others showed concentrations of heavy metals far exceeding acceptable limits. A baby food lawsuit lawyer uses this evidence as a foundation for building your family's case.

Who Should Consider Filing a Baby Food Lawsuit?
Parents who may qualify for working with a baby food lawsuit lawyer are those whose children consumed name-brand infant cereals or purees before age three and who later been evaluated for autism spectrum disorder, sensory processing issues, or behavioral disorders linked to lead or arsenic ingestion.
When your child consumed the food matters in these cases. As neurotoxic substances have the most severe impact when the neurological system is forming, infants affected between six months and two years tend to develop the clearest symptoms and diagnoses. Parents don't need to show exactly which batch caused the harm — a baby food lawsuit lawyer can work with medical timelines and product data to build the connection.
Caregivers who question whether their child's situation qualifies can always reach out for an evaluation. There is no obligation after the initial meeting. However, waiting too long can result in missing the statute of limitations — which differs depending on jurisdiction.

Which baby food brands are named in these lawsuits?A number of well-known brands have been named in baby food contamination lawsuits, including Walmart's Parent's Choice brand and others. A 2021 U.S. House Subcommittee report documented how these companies sold products containing arsenic, lead, and cadmium many times higher than what regulators consider safe. Your attorney can confirm which foods were used has been named in claims.
What if I threw away the baby food packaging?Most parents don't have the product containers their children consumed years ago — and that's okay. Bank and credit card statements can document buying history. In many cases, your child's pediatrician may have documented the foods introduced at various ages.
